What is Chromium Picolinate 800?

Chromium Picolinate 800 is a capsule or tablet supplement that provides chromium bound to picolinic acid, a pairing chosen to help the mineral be absorbed. Each serving supplies 800 micrograms of elemental chromium, a higher strength than many standard products.

As a food supplement, it is intended to complement normal nutrition where the everyday diet may be low in this trace mineral. It is not formulated, tested or approved as a treatment for any medical condition.


How Chromium Picolinate 800 works

Chromium is thought to support the action of insulin, the hormone that helps move glucose from the blood into cells. Within a food supplement framework, Chromium Picolinate 800 may support normal glucose metabolism in people whose intake of the mineral is low.

The evidence in healthy, well nourished adults is mixed, so no dramatic effect should be expected. A higher dose is not automatically more effective, and it works best as a small addition to a sensible eating pattern.

Who should avoid it

Some people should not take chromium supplements without medical advice. In general, avoid this supplement if you are in any of the following groups, unless your doctor says otherwise:

  • Pregnant or breastfeeding women.
  • Children and teenagers under 18.
  • People with kidney or liver disease.
  • Anyone taking diabetes medicine, because blood sugar could drop too low.

Drug interactions

Chromium can interact with prescription and over the counter medicines, so tell your doctor about everything you take.

  • Diabetes medicines and insulin, because chromium may add to their blood sugar lowering effect.
  • Levothyroxine and some thyroid medicines, which are best separated by several hours.
  • Certain antacids and stomach medicines, which may affect how chromium is absorbed.

Never adjust a prescribed medicine on your own because you have started a supplement.


Warnings and contraindications for Chromium Picolinate 800

Do not exceed the recommended dose. Because this is a high strength product, be especially careful not to stack it with other chromium supplements. Very high or long term intake of chromium has been linked in rare reports to stomach upset and, uncommonly, to liver or kidney effects.

Buy only from a trusted pharmacy, check the pack and seal, and stop use immediately if you notice a rash, severe stomach pain, or signs of low blood sugar such as shaking, sweating or confusion.
